Tree-shaped photovoltaic panels
Tree-shaped solar panels feature a central trunk with branches extending at various angles, capturing sunlight from different positions throughout the day. Unlike traditional flat solar arrays that require clearing large areas of land, these vertical structures need minimal ground. . Engineers have created innovative solar structures that mimic natural trees, with photovoltaic panels arranged like leaves on branches. These solar trees are changing how we think about renewable energy in both urban and natural settings. 3D geometric design of solar trees. They are exactly what they sound like; solar panel installations put on ground-mounted displays that can resemble trees.
